Abstract

The utility model relates to the technical field of drainage tubes, in particular to a drainage tube for antibody detection, which comprises a drainage branch tube, wherein a first drainage cap is fixedly arranged on the surface of the drainage branch tube, an inner branch butt joint tube is fixedly arranged on the inner side of the first drainage cap, an inner branch placing groove is formed in the inner side of the first drainage cap, the drainage tube for antibody detection drives an inner branch fixing plate to slide on the inner wall of the inner branch placing groove through an inner branch adjusting plate, and then the inner branch fixing plate pushes a sealing rubber cushion to slide on the inner wall of the inner branch placing groove so as to form extrusion butt joint with a drainage tube body of an inner branch butt joint tube meter body.

Description

Drainage tube for antibody detection
Technical Field
The utility model belongs to the technical field of drainage tubes, and particularly relates to a drainage tube for antibody detection.
Background
The purpose of specific antibody detection is to assist clinical diagnosis, and is an index for observing curative effect and prognosis in certain diseases, and the detection of specific antibody has special and important significance in observation of vaccination effect and epidemiological investigation of infectious diseases.
When the drainage tube is used, the relevant antibody detection liquid is communicated through the connection of the drainage tube, then the relevant sample of the antibody detection is conducted, when the existing majority of drainage tubes for the antibody detection are installed and used, the drainage tube for the antibody detection with the adaptive length is generally selected according to the actual use environment, so that the drainage tube for the antibody detection needs to be replaced and used when the operation environment needs to be replaced, and the operation mode has the defects that the drainage tube for the antibody detection cannot be connected and used in a matched mode rapidly and conveniently when the drainage tube for the antibody detection is used, so that the operation space is limited when the antibody detection is caused.

Referring to fig. 1-5, the present utility model provides a technical solution: the utility model provides a drainage tube for antibody detection, includes drainage branch pipe 1, and the surface fixed mounting of drainage branch pipe 1 has first drainage block 2, and outer branch butt joint groove 3 has been seted up on the surface of first drainage block 2, and the inner wall sliding connection of outer branch butt joint groove 3 has drainage tube body 4, and the surface fixed mounting of drainage tube body 4 has negative pressure ball 5.
Specifically, when carrying out antibody detection drainage through drainage tube body 4, negative pressure ball 5 then is supplementary drainage tube body 4 and carries out negative pressure drainage and use, the rapidity of guarantee drainage tube body 4 initial drainage.
Further, an inner branch butt joint pipe 6 is fixedly arranged on the inner side of the first drainage cap 2, and the inner branch butt joint pipe 6 is used for butt joint positioning with the drainage tube body 4.
Further, an inner branch placing groove 7 is formed in the inner side of the first drainage cap 2, an inner branch fixing plate 8 is slidably connected to the inner wall of the inner branch placing groove 7, an inner branch adjusting plate 9 is fixedly arranged on the surface of the inner branch fixing plate 8, an inner branch limit groove 10 is formed in the inner side of the first drainage cap 2, an inner branch limit plate 11 is slidably connected to the inner wall of the inner branch limit groove 10, the surface of the inner branch limit plate 11 is fixedly arranged on the surface of the inner branch adjusting plate 9, an elastic component 12 is slidably sleeved on the surface of the inner branch adjusting plate 9, two ends of the elastic component 12 are fixedly arranged on the surface of the inner branch adjusting plate 9 and the surface of the inner branch limit plate 11 respectively, a sealing rubber gasket 13 is fixedly arranged on the inner wall of the inner branch placing groove 7, an outer branch spiral ring 14 is formed in the surface of the first drainage cap 2, an outer branch spiral ring 15 is in threaded connection with the inner wall of the outer branch spiral ring 14, the inner side of the outer branch 15 and the surface of the inner branch adjusting plate 9 are inclined, and an auxiliary spiral ring 16 is fixedly arranged on the surface of the outer branch 15.
Specifically, when installing drainage through drainage tube body 4 and using, drainage tube body 4 can dock with the help of the first drainage block 2 on the drainage branch pipe 1, after drainage tube body 4 gets into the inner wall of outer branch butt joint groove 3 and dock with interior branch butt joint pipe 6, medical control outer branch spiral 15 rotates at the inner wall of outer branch helicoidal groove 14, outer branch spiral 15 can assist the rotation through the auxiliary stay plate 16 of table body, outer branch spiral 15 forms the extrusion to the inclined plane of interior branch regulating plate 9 through inboard slope form, and then interior branch regulating plate 9 drives interior branch fixed plate 8 and slides at the inner wall of interior branch standing groove 7, then interior branch fixed plate 8 promotes sealed cushion 13 and forms extrusion butt joint to the drainage tube body 4 of interior branch butt joint pipe 6 table body, convenient butt joint with the cooperation pipe is used when drainage tube body 4 has been ensured in such operating means, the drawback that can not carry out quick external drainage tube body 4 cooperation use according to the service condition when traditional drainage tube body 4 is used has been improved drainage tube body 4 and can be used according to actual environment and make up drainage tube body 4 convenient and use when using.
Further, the second drainage cap 19 is fixedly arranged at the lower end of the drainage branch pipe 1, the structure on the second drainage cap 19 is identical to the structure on the first drainage cap 2, and the drainage pipe body 4 can be installed in a multi-section connection mode through the cooperation of the second drainage cap 19 and the first drainage cap 2.
Further, the surface fixed mounting of the inner branch fixing plate 8 has the reinforcing plate 17, and the reinforcing groove 18 has been seted up on the surface of drainage tube body 4, and when the inner branch butt joint pipe 6 of the body of drainage tube body 4 was fixed through the inner branch fixing plate 8, the reinforcing plate 17 on the inner branch fixing plate 8 can extrude drainage tube body 4 dislocation entering reinforcing groove 18's inner wall, then makes drainage tube body 4 form stable fixed in the inboard of first drainage block 2.
Working principle: when the drainage tube for antibody detection is used by installing drainage through the drainage tube body 4, the drainage tube body 4 can be in butt joint by means of the first drainage cap 2 on the drainage branch tube 1, after the drainage tube body 4 enters the inner wall of the outer branch butt joint groove 3 and is in butt joint with the inner branch butt joint tube 6, the medical care control outer branch spiral ring 15 rotates on the inner wall of the outer branch spiral groove 14, the outer branch spiral ring 15 can assist in rotating through the auxiliary support plate 16 of the meter body, the outer branch spiral ring 15 forms extrusion through the inclined surface of the inner branch adjusting plate 9 in an inclined mode, the inner branch adjusting plate 9 drives the inner branch fixing plate 8 to slide on the inner wall of the inner branch placing groove 7, and then the inner branch fixing plate 8 pushes the sealing rubber cushion 13 to slide on the inner wall of the inner branch placing groove 7 to form extrusion butt joint on the drainage tube body 4 of the meter body of the inner branch butt joint tube 6.
